Cranko! #6  March 2026

A brand-new issue bursting at the seams with fresh news from every corner of the Playdate world!

This time, we went full trench-coat journalism: rummaging through bins and even bribing the postal worker delivering mail to the creator of Post Hero, all to dig up every last juicy detail on the newest entry in the series: Bedbeard’s Revenge. So don’t go burning your fingertips trying to steam open envelopes like some bargain-bin spy. At Cranko!, we’ve got the hottest gossip doing the rounds on this long-awaited sequel.

But once the last envelope’s been cracked open, reality comes knocking: is it still worth making games for Playdate?

Whether you’ve been wrestling with that question for ages or you’re just about to dive in, we’ve put together an exclusive report to help you make the smartest call possible. Built on input from no fewer than fifty respected Playdate developers, it paints a broad, brutally honest picture of where the market stands right now.

What do you need to know to avoid a total disaster? What are the smartest moves if you want to come out ahead? And how do you make the best use of your time, money, and rapidly vanishing hours of sleep when bringing a new Playdate game into the world?

Real numbers, Catalog case studies, hard-earned advice, and not a hint of sugar-coating.

You wanted reviews? You got reviews. Dozens of pages of them, plus interviews. Our own fresh analysis joins the chorus around some of the most incredible games to land in recent weeks. And that’s not all: we’re also debuting a brand-new feature: the battle of  reviews!.

 

And we’re still not halfway through the issue. Next up is the latest instalment of our special 3D games section, where we sit down with Frédéric Souchu for an in-depth look at his latest project, Power Off  – a beast of a game that looks ready to tear through fans of fast, furious, Doom-style action. Hard facts, deep-cut references, and coding tricks nasty enough to leave your head spinning. Promise.
